Solvent-Free and Selective Oxidation of Hydroxy Groups to their Corresponding Carbonyl Functions with Ferric Nitrate Activated by Heteropoly Acids

Abstract

Keggin-type heteropoly acids revealed high catalytic activity for swift and selective oxidation of various hydroxy functionalities to the corresponding carbonyl groups using ferric nitrate as an oxidant under mild and solvent-free conditions. We have found that the catalytic activities of the heteropoly acids were much higher than mineral or solid acids such as sulfuric acid, p-toluenesulfonic acid, triflic acid, acidic Amberlyst-15, Montmorillonite-K10 clay, and HY-zeolite.
